Where to watch Bills vs Browns: TV channel, live stream for Week 16 game

News RoomBy News RoomDecember 21, 2025No Comments3 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Telegram Copy Link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email WhatsApp

The Browns have nothing to lose and a lot to gain. Already eliminated and with no playoff aspirations, Cleveland wants to take advantage of the end of the season to establish and consolidate Shedeur Sanders as quarterback. The Bills are an ideal opponent to work on his temperament, character and pressure.

They host a Bills team motivated by the win over New England and with Josh Allen looking to get into the best possible postseason rhythm and fulfill the dream of being in a Super Bowl now that the Chiefs are no longer in the way.

Buffalo wants the lead in the AFC East and Cleveland wants to avoid last place in the AFC North, so they are fighting with the Bengals for that decorous finish to the season.

Recent history: slight advantage to Cleveland

The Browns hold the all-time regular season record against the Bills with 12 wins and 10 losses. Playing at home, Cleveland has a 7-4 record against Buffalo.

The last time they met was in 2022; the victory went to the Bills by 31-23.

The good news for the Browns: Myles Garrett

The defensive end is one sack away from tying the NFL’s single-season sack record of 22.5, and 1.5 away from breaking it. He leads the league with 21.5 sacks.Allen has recorded at least one sack in 12 of 14 games this season, while Garrett has registered at least half a sack in 11 of 14 games. It looks like there will be a new mark to boast about in Cleveland.

The key to the game: stop Josh Allen

The Buffalo quarterback has one of the best arms in the NFL and has the added bonus of being able to escape pressure using his legs to extend plays. He throws to all areas of the field, as well as passes outside the scheme.

This season he has completed 284 of 406 pass attempts for 3,276 passing yards and 25 touchdowns. He has thrown a total of 10 interceptions and has been sacked 33 times.The Browns’ pass defense is the best in the league, allowing the fewest passing yards per game, with an average of 169.1 yards. This could play in Cleveland’s favor if they can figure out and stop Allen on the Bills’ early drives.

What should Cleveland look for? The ground attack

The Browns can take advantage of the ground game to create opportunities in the air attack against the Bills, as Buffalo allows an average of 143.1 rushing yards per game, which ranks them 30th in the league.

Cleveland averages 92.4 rushing yards per game, ranking 29th in the league, but if they can balance the ground game and the passing game, quarterback Shedeur Sanders will be able to reap the rewards.

Where and when to watch Bills vs. Browns?

Date: Sunday, December 21, 2025

Time: 1 p.m. ET

Location: Huntington Bank Field, Cleveland

TV: CBS

Streaming: NFL+
